ANGELAKI
journal of the theoretical humanities

volume 6 number 1 april 2001
special issue: SUBALTERN AFFECT
issue editors: Jon Beasley-Murray and Alberto Moreiras

CONTENTS

Editorial Introduction: Subalternity and Affect
-- Jon Beasley-Murray and Alberto Moreiras

Separation and the Politics of Theory
-- Alberto Moreiras

Subject Scenes, Symbolic Exclusion, and Subalternity
-- Brian Carr

Making an Example of Spivak
-- David Huddart

The Sovereign Individual, "Subalternity," and Becoming-Other
-- Kenneth Surin

Feeling, the Subaltern, and the Organic Intellectual
-- Brett Levinson

Managing Ecstasy: A Subaltern Performative of Resistance
-- Samir Dayal

Reflections on the Origin: Transculturation and Tragedy in _Pedro
Páramo_
-- Patrick Dove

Tribalism, Globalism, and Eskimo Television in Leslie Marmon Silko's
_Almanac of the Dead_
-- Eva Cherniavsky

Hear Say Yes in Piglia: _La ciudad ausente_, Posthegemony, and the
"Fin-negans" of Historicity
-- Gareth Williams

Porno-Revolution: _El fiord_ and the Eva-Peronist State
-- John Kraniauskas

Trashing Whiteness: _Pulp Fiction_, _Se7en_, _Strange Days_, and
Articulating Affect
-- Paul Gormley

East of the Sun and West of the Moon: The Balkans and Cultural Studies
-- Arthur Redding

Anti-Fascism as Child's Play: The Political Line in _The Laurels 
of Lake Constance_
-- Jon Beasley-Murray
